## Changelog — Wagevault exporter v3.2

The payroll export moved from fixed-width to the Ledgerline CSV format, and the old `EXPORT_KEY` setting was renamed to reflect the new endpoint. On-call should update each tenant's env file during the maintenance window; the old name is ignored. The renamed export signing secret goes on the next line.

vault entry, kafog-yahop: COURIER_KEY8=0faa53ae

# Commission Scheme v2 (Managers Only)

Welcome aboard — here's the quick tour. We scrapped the old flat-rate payout last spring; it rewarded volume over margin and the Brennick line suffered for it. The new scheme pays accelerators on renewals and penalizes heavy discounting. Reps grumbled for a month, then adapted. Numbers are trending right. The confidential plan behind this shift sits below.

internal memo for kawip-hadug: Headcount on the Wenwyn team goes from 7 to 140 by the end of January. Gross margin on Wenwyn came in at 20 percent against a plan of 15 percent.

Subject: Cut-over complete — planner regression fix

Hi all,

For those new to the Quillbase team: last night we cut over to the patched query planner after the v4.2 regression caused join reordering to pick seq scans on large partitions. Traffic moved to the new fleet in two stages, latency is back to baseline, and the old planners are parked for a week in case we need to compare plans. No data changes were involved. The new fleet runs with these settings:

deployment values, kajep-kageg:
[praix]
host = praix.paliqcorp.corp
user = praix_svc
database = praix_prod

**Q: Are the lifts running this weekend?** No. Both lifts in the Halloway Annexe are down for winch maintenance Saturday 06:00 to Sunday 18:00. Direct staff to the east stairwell. Goods deliveries should be deferred or rerouted via the Penfold loading dock. Contractors from Bray Vertical Systems will be on site; they sign in at the facilities desk as normal. The stairwell door locks after 19:00, so anyone working late will need the weekend access code. Issue it only to rostered staff. The code is below.

badge for bawef-bahap: bdg-LALUM-4